Richard Ofori has finally completed his move to Maritzburg in the South African topflight league.
Ghana goalkeeper Richard Ofori has signed a three-year contract with Maritzburg in the Premier Soccer League (PSL).
Ofori has been a target of several South African sides and had gone for trials on numerous occasion in his quest to seek greener pastures overseas.
It was reported last week that the Ghana international was close to joining Mamelodi Sundowns, who are the champions of Africa, but the deal fell through and it is understood he wanted to be assured of regular playing time before putting pen to paper.
Richard Ofori in the end settled on Maritzburg and he is expected to earn regular place in the starting line up to keep his spot in the Black Stars.
The ‘Team of Choice’ took to their Twitter handle to confirm signing the 23-year-old on a three-year deal
Richard Ofori helped Wa All Stars to emerge as the first club from the three Northern region of Ghana to win the Ghana Premier League last season.
